Pros

I've worked with several contracting companies that serve school districts and EdTheory has by far been my favorite. My recruiter, Rahul, is absolutely wonderful to work with, and unlike other recruiter experiences I have had, he always has my best interest at heart. He is willing to work with me from day one to support my needs, including negotiating a very competitive pay rate for me. He's always prompt in communicating between me and the district, and in answering questions I have. Negotiating a contract with EdTheory was very easy and transparent. They have generous bonuses and allot a materials budget if you're in a district with limited resources. There's a lot of room to grow at EdTheory as they have contracts around the Bay area, and an international volunteer option. Of all of the companies that I've contracted with, EdTheory has the least amount of redundant paperwork and easiest HR system to navigate. Working with HR was always delightful. They were always willing to help and is exceedingly patient. Every staff person I have worked with at EdTheory is genuinely interested in supporting me and ensuring job satisfaction. The work-life balance and company culture set EdTheory apart. I highly recommend speaking with Rahul, or any of the friendly staff at EdTheory if you are interested in school-based work in the Bay area.

Cons

The only reason I left was to continue non-profit/public work for the Public Service Loan Forgiveness Program. I didn't experience any cons with this company.
